  3. My brothers 10 pt he got a couple of years ago was shot in the morning around 9am. It was shot on a drive the guy who shot it took a Texas heart shot and hit the right ham. Bullet passed through the muscle and exited out the rib cage. Did a number on the muscle. That deer survived until 2pm when my brother shot it. The guys tracked the deer and jumped it a number of times and pushed it on to my property. I think he would of survived unless infection got to him. I also believe the deer was running at the time of the shot, not good odds.
  4. Don't hear much of anyone doing this or at least talking about it. There was a time I used to rattle a lot. Back when Peter Fiduccia and Len Lee Rue came out with that video. I bought the synthetic horns and all. In all my years hunting I have rattled in one buck. He was a small 6 pt. Anyone else out there have more luck or experience. It is something cool to do when your having no luck and need to try different.

  13. I also think that without a mandatory checking system this will always happen. Years ago we would have to stop at two check points along rt 17, on our way home to Long Island. Today you breeze on by no checks. Hell, we had two bucks on top of the truck two years ago parked at a gas station. Trooper pulled in right along side of us and didn't pay any mind to us. Give people and inch, and they will take a foot!
